Dennis Rodman has been ordered to pay more than $42,000 in back taxes to the State of California.
DENNIS RODMAN, the former Chicago Bulls NBA star, owes over $42,000 in unpaid taxes, reports the Los Angeles Times.A tax lien of $42,497 was filed against Rodman back on 11th May 2010 in California's Orange County. However, the 49-year-old's business manager PEGGY KING denies that such debt exists, saying, "We just got a refund check from the state for $42,000 or $43,000. If you owed the money, you'd never get a check from them ... it's got to be incorrect". It's not the first time that the NBA star has found himself in trouble over unpaid taxes. Back in 2007, the IRS filed a $165,818 lien against him, and in 2006 a $283,087 lien was filed. The news comes shortly before Rodman is due to be honoured by the Detroit Pistons NBA team. The 49-year-old played the first seven seasons of his career in Detroit and the team are set to retire his legendary No. 10 jersey during a halftime show on 1st April 2011.
In recent years, Rodman has made a number of television appearances, most recently on 'Celebrity Apprentice' in 2009. His misbehaviour on the show led to his family and friends urging him to seek rehabilitation and he appeared on 'Celebrity Rehab with Dr Drew' in 2010.
